Paul Gauguin is a Delbard floribunda rose with large romantic blooms blending pastel yellow, orange and coral reflections, repeated flowering from May until the first frost and good resistance to disease.\n    \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n    \u003cp class=\"fr-pdp-note\"\u003e\n      Choose it if you want an expressive rose whose changing colours create a distinctive focal point without requiring strong fragrance to command attention.\n    \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n\n  \u003cdetails\u003e\n\n    \u003csummary\u003e\n      \u003cspan class=\"fr-pdp-summary-row\"\u003eFull Description →\u003c\/span\u003e\n    \u003c\/summary\u003e\n\n    \u003cdiv class=\"fr-pdp-content\"\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eFull Description:\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\n        Paul Gauguin brings the feeling of a painted canvas into the garden. Its colours do not appear as a single flat shade; they meet, soften and change across the petals, creating blooms that invite a second look each time they open.\n      \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\n        Named after the celebrated French artist, this Delbard creation reflects the expressive use of colour associated with his work. Pastel yellow and warm orange mingle with coral reflections, producing flowers that feel rich and luminous without becoming harsh or overly bright.\n      \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\n        Because the tones develop naturally as each bloom matures, the flowers can vary subtly from one stage to another. This gives the plant the character of a living composition, with fresh colour combinations appearing throughout the flowering season.\n      \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\n        Introduced in 2006, Paul Gauguin is a floribunda rose with large, romantic flowers carried above healthy foliage. It flowers repeatedly from May until the first frost, ensuring that its warm palette returns in successive flushes rather than appearing for only a short period.\n      \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\n        The plant reaches approximately 90 to 100 cm in height and has a balanced habit suitable for rose beds, mixed borders and specimen planting. A spacing of around 50 cm allows each plant to develop well while also creating a full display when several are planted together.\n      \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\n        Paul Gauguin has good resistance to disease and is equally rewarding in the garden or cut for floral arrangements. The flowers generally remain attractive for around five days in a vase, bringing their distinctive colouring indoors.\n      \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n      \u003cp\u003e\n        This is a rose for gardeners who see planting as a form of composition.
